The size of Gooburrum is approximately 27.1 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 0.4% of total area. The population of Gooburrum in 2011 was 1,466 people. By 2016 the population was 1,434 showing a population decline of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gooburrum is 50-59 years. Households in Gooburrum are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gooburrum work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 88.1% of the homes in Gooburrum were owner-occupied compared with 87.5% in 2016.
